Learning and Research in Virtual Worlds

Aleks Krotoski and I edited this special issue of Learning Media  & Technology on the topic of Learning and Research in Virtual Worlds.  We were both completing our Ph.D. at the time, so it took a bit longer than we thought it would, but it came out great!   This is related to our Learning and Research in Second Life workshops, which are still going on today.
